Mariculture is a part of aquaculture business, which enhances the production of seafood through rearing of fishes in saltwater condition or marine aquaculture. It is reared in an enclosed section of the ocean, or in tanks, cages locked ponds or raceways. It also cultured aquatic plants such as seaweeds and microphytes for nutritional and industrial end use. Mariculture has been a major business in the coastal areas for the last few decades. This provides food, employment, and essential products from multiple marine sources. Increasing population across the globe has led to a rise in demand for seafood. Additionally, seafood such as salmon, tuna, cod, prawns, oysters, lobster, mackerel, anchovies, and crabs are popularly consumed across the globe. These are also considered commercial seafood, which generate significant revenue and in turn drive the mariculture market. Increase in demand for marine-based products is anticipated to drive the global mariculture market during the forecast period.
The global mariculture market can be segmented based on type, culture or rearing, operation, material, and geography. In terms of type, the global mariculture market can be bifurcated into seawater ponds, tank farming, algaculture, sea cage farming, long line farming, raceway farming, fish hatcheries, and integrated multitrophic mariculture.

In terms of region, the global mariculture market can be segmented into North America, Europe, Asia Pacific, Middle East & Africa, and South America. Increase in demand for seafood along with seaweeds has boosted the mariculture in North America. Dependence on seafood for consumption in the Caribbean region is driving mariculture market in North America. The presence of a long coastline equipped with strong marine technology propels the mariculture market in Europe. In Asia Pacific, mariculture seems to be prominent owing to the demand for marine products from the last four decades.
